The House passed, 232-183, a resolution to remove the deadline for ratification of the Equal Rights Amendment to the U.S. Constitution. The measure now goes to the Senate. Congress approved the ERA in 1972. Thirty-five states ratified it by 1978 (needs 38), one year before the deadline. However, five states rescinded their ratification by then. Congress extended the deadline to 1982. Nothing changed before that deadline. FBI Director Christopher Wray testified at an oversight hearing before the House Judiciary Committee. The FBI director addressed Justice Department Inspector General Michael Horowitz's December 2019 report on FISA abuse allegations during the 2016 election. "The failures highlighted in that report are unacceptable, period. They don't reflect who the FBI is as an institution and they cannot be repeated," he said. Director Wray added that his agency was implementing all of the recommendations made in the report and was taking even further steps to ensure higher accountability. Senate Minority Leader Chuck Schumer (D-NY) and other Democratic senators held a news conference shortly after the vote on the Iran War Powers resolution. The resolution passed 55-45. Sen. Schumer told reporters that it was a "rare day" in the Senate and congratulated the bipartisan support for the resolution. President Trump has said he plans to veto the resolution which aims to stop the president from use of military force against Iran without congressional approval. Sen. Tim Kaine (D-VA), author of the resolution, said the government owed it to our troops and their families to give "careful deliberation" of war and cautioned President Trump to not veto the resolution. 11:51 PM EST Approx. 1 hr. 55 min. The Center for Strategic and International Studies held a discussion on post-Brexit foreign and security policy with former British Defense Secretary Liam Fox. His remarks came just a few days after the U.K. officially left the European Union after 47 years as a member state. The former defense secretary said the U.K. would not enter an era of withdrawal and isolationism and would retain their global leadership in the world with membership in international bodies like, the U.N. Social Security Administration officials testified before the Senate Aging Committee on efforts to protect seniors from social security impersonation scams. Sen. Susan Collins (R-ME), who chaired the two hour-hearing, said these types of scams were the number one report scam to the committee's fraud lines. Ranking member Bob Casey (D-PA) played a recording of a impersonation scam that one of his staffers received in the previous week.
